Indian batting maestro Sachin Tendulkar has returned early from India’s tour of Sri Lanka, and will miss the Twenty20 international on Tuesday.
Team India manager Prakash Dixit said that Tendulkar left for Mumbai on Sunday night since he was not part of the Twenty20 squad
Tendulkar, who played in the first three ODIs, had a torrid time in the first three games of the tour.
He was rested for the final two ODIs after India won the first three games to seal the series. The five-match contest finished 4-1 in India’s favour.
Tendulkar has not been a regular member of the India’s teams for the 20-over format. His only Twenty20 international, in December 2006, was on the tour of South Africa.
